Broken flex caused the phone to die?

I was opening my iPhone, when the phone was on. I think the flex cable of the screen broke, because i was seeing lines, and the display was slowly fading. Now, when i try to turn it on, there are no signs of life, I even tried mute/unmute switch, but the vibration didnt work. Is there a possibility i burned something on the motherboard? Because if only the display was broken, the vibration would work. Please help ?

Your screen has become faulty and needs to be replaced. You logic board is probably fine. Your phone will not vibrate or be recognised by your pc or mac until it is unlocked to the home screen.

iPhones have a very specific procedure for opening them, which includes disconnecting the battery flex before any other flex cable. Chances are very probable you may have shorted something inside the phone if you did not follow the routine. Not worry though, there is a fix available. If you are familiar with micro soldering, you could fix it yourself, if not, sending it into a capable phone repair shop that provides this service would be your best option. If on the outside chance it is not repairable, (extreme case), they should be able to retrieve any information you have on it.
